What is the difference?
- 1Size: Kitchen is typically larger and more spacious than a scullery.
- 2Function: Kitchen is primarily used for cooking and food preparation, while scullery is used for cleaning and dishwashing.
- 3Equipment: Kitchen contains appliances and tools for cooking, while scullery contains sinks and cleaning supplies.
- 4Location: Kitchen is usually located near the dining area, while scullery is often located adjacent to the kitchen.
- 5Usage: Kitchen is used for meal preparation and cooking, while scullery is used for cleaning and dishwashing after meals.
Remember this!
Kitchen and scullery are both rooms used in a house or building for food preparation and cleaning. However, the difference between kitchen and scullery is their size, function, equipment, location, and usage. A kitchen is a larger space used for cooking and food preparation, while a scullery is a smaller space used for cleaning and dishwashing.
